Koodos, established in 2023, has accelerated its investments by 140% in the past year through a purpose-driven strategy. The firm offers structured access to venture opportunities with FCA oversight and a founder-first approach. Co-founders Nat Hutley, Ian Hubert, and Peter Ward emphasize a human approach to investment, focusing on healthcare, life sciences, and oncology. Koodos has raised over £30 million from 350+ investors, supporting innovative biotech companies aimed at revolutionizing cancer treatment. The firm aims to create meaningful impact beyond financial returns.
